General presentation of Kion Group

Let's find out who Kion Group is and what its different activities are in order to have a better visibility on its sources of income and its major challenges for the years to come.

The Kion Group is a German company operating in the industrial equipment sector. More specifically, the company is currently the European market leader and number two worldwide in the manufacture and sale of material handling equipment.

To better understand the group's activities, they can be divided into several divisions according to the share of turnover they generate and in this way:

  • First of all, the major part of Kion Group's activities concerns the sale of handling equipment with more than 72.7% of the turnover. This includes electric and diesel forklift trucks, pallet trucks, stackers, electric and thermal front-end trucks, tractors and forwarders, warehouse trucks, order pickers and others under the Linde, STILL, Fenwick, OM Still, Baoli and Voltas brands. The group is also active in the sale of spare parts and after-sales services.
  • 27% of the group's turnover then comes from the development and sale of supply chain management solutions.
  • Finally, the remaining 0.3% of turnover comes from IT and logistics services.

It is also interesting to know the geographical distribution of Kion Group's activities as it generates 67.1% of its turnover in Europe, 19.1% in North America, 10.3% in Asia Pacific, 2.4% in Latin America and 1.1% in Africa and Middle East.

The major competitors of Kion Group

Let's take a look at the Kion Group's business sector with a presentation of three of its main competitors in the market and their activities:

Toyota 

This Japanese group is currently a world-famous car manufacturer but also a manufacturer of forklifts and other handling equipment.

Jungheinrich

The German group Jungheinrich, based in Hamburg, is one of the leaders in the handling equipment sector worldwide and also offers storage and goods flow management equipment. It is number two in Europe after Kion.

Nacco Industries

Finally, the US company Nacco Industries also specializes in this sector as well as in the mining industries and in small appliances and specialty retail.


The major partners of Kion Group

Of course, Kion Group also has some allies and regularly enters into strategic partnerships with other companies. Here are two examples of such recent partnerships:

Dematic

First of all, in 2016, it was not a partnership as such but the acquisition of a company that Kion made. This was the American company Dematic, which it acquired for €2 billion. This company, which employs 6,000 people in 22 countries and has a turnover of 1.8 billion dollars, enables Kion Group to become a leader in its sector worldwide and to strengthen its position in the United States.

Weichai Power

A little later, Kion Group joined forces with Weicha Power, a Chinese vehicle and component manufacturer. The two companies signed a long-term partnership agreement whereby Weichai Power acquired a 25% stake in Kion and a 70% majority stake in Kion's hydraulic business. How was Kion Group created?

The Kion Group as we know it today was founded in 2006. Kion was formerly part of the Linde Group, which in 2006 decided to sell its Material Handling division, including Fenwick-Linde forklift trucks and warehouse technology, under the name Kion in order to finance the takeover of BOC. This transaction brought in 4 billion euros and Kion was bought by a financial consortium consisting of KKR and Golman Sachs.
